JAVA和Nginx 教程大全

网站首页 > 精选教程 正文

Spring MVC中对日期类型的处理 实现一个springmvc的日期类型转换器

wys521 2024-11-12 14:23:42 精选教程 32 ℃ 0 评论

前言:

方向:Java-Spring MVC-Date

案例目标:处理Spring MVC传参过程中日期类型转换问题;

案例小知识:

Spring MVC;

xml配置;

注解的使用

1.环境搭建

1.1、创建web项目,结构如下所示:

1.2、配置文件

web.xml文件

spring mvc.xml文件

1.3、创建实体类

1.4、创建控制层

1.5、页面

添加页面(add.jsp):

列表展示页面(list.jsp):

项目搭建完毕。

2.日期处理

处理日期类型有很多方式,此处介绍两种常用的方式:注解方式,自定义转换器方式;

2.1、方式1(注解式):

在类中日期属性上添加注解@DateTimeFormat()

2.2、方式2(转换器式):

创建日期转换类,实现Converter接口:

为日期转换类配置xml

注意:

后台配置的日期格式必须要和前台页面的输入格式保持一致,否则会报404畸形语法错误,其中页面date输入框可以支持“yyyy-MM-dd”格式。

3.测试展示效果

小结:关于Spring MVC中日期类转换处理有很多方法,以上推荐两种比较常用的方法(首推注解式),如果仅仅传一个日期类型是需要创建转换类的,不过,一般情况下传入对象用注解的方法就可以。

声明:此文内容已经过测试可用,若有问题请及时联系小编;

此文仅支持交流学习之用,不支持用做它途,欢迎大家交流指正。

本文暂时没有评论,来添加一个吧(●'◡'●)

欢迎 发表评论:

最近发表
标签列表